We’re hiring cooks and a dishwasher to join our  team at The Ark in Deer Isle, Maine from May through October. This past year, our restaurant was named one of the Top 50 Restaurants in the country by The New York Times, and we’re building on that momentum with a team that cares about the work—and about each other.

What sets us apart:

  • Rent-free housing for the season. Enjoy your own room and live within walking (or kayaking!) distance from work

  • You’ll work in a kitchen that has received national recognition, while still being small and hands-on

  • We are an LGBTQ and Latino-owned business, and we care deeply about building an inclusive, respectful workplace

  • We invest in our team: family meal, team gatherings, and ongoing education, such as a speaker series, are part of the job

  • Our kitchen is collaborative by design, with close interaction between cooks, leadership, and Chefs in Residence throughout the season


What you’ll do:
Cooks work on the hot line and cold station during  service—for both our Dining Room and Tavern. Our menus evolve throughout the season, shaped by ingredients and a rotating group of Chefs in Residence, so adaptability and engagement matter.
Dishwashers keep the kitchen running—cleaning, organizing, and supporting the team wherever needed. It’s a critical role in a small operation, and we treat it that way. Also, we just renovated the dishpit: new sink, new dish machine, new walls and floor. It's sparkling.


Who we are:
New owners took over the inn in 2025, bringing a fresh perspective to a storied place while honoring its roots as a home built in 1793. We are stewards committed to building deeper connections to the things that make Deer Isle special. Our interests are rooted in community, sustainability, and creativity, and they influence every aspect of the inn, including the dining experience. Deer Isle’s breathtaking natural beauty, diverse arts scene, and abundance of local farmers, purveyors, and producers inspire us, and we strive to celebrate them through our food and beverage program. We take the work seriously—food, service, and consistency—but we also believe a good kitchen is built on respect, communication, and showing up for each other day after day.


Where you’ll be:
Deer Isle is a vibrant coastal community full of artists; writers; fishermen and women; and those who love the outdoors. It’s  beautiful and requires a certain mindset—there’s more ocean and woods than nightlife. We are an island linked to the main land by a bridge—so we're off the beaten path but not so remote that you feel disconnected.


When:
May through October, with a full-season commitment required for rent-free housing


Room & Board:
Housing is provided rent-free and located close to the inn. One staff meal is included per shift.
